Normacol 6,2 g per 10 g Granules.
Clinical Summary
Quick overview from the medicine insert
Indication
Treatment of constipation and management of colostomies.
Dosage (summary)
1-2 heaped measures once or twice daily after meals for adults.
Onset of Action / Duration
Onset: 12-72 hours, Duration: Not specified
Special Populations
- Elderly
- Renal impairment
- Hepatic impairment
Pregnancy & Breastfeeding
Safe for use in pregnancy and lactation.
Key Drug Interactions
- May interfere with absorption of other medicines
Contraindications
- Hypersensitivity to sterculia
- Intestinal obstruction
- Faecal impaction
- Children under 6 years
Common side effects
- Allergic reactions
- Oesophageal obstruction
- Intestinal obstruction
- Diarrhoea
- Nausea
Counselling Points
- Take with plenty of water
- Do not take before bed
- Consult doctor if bowel habits change
Serious warnings
- Risk of dependence on laxatives
- Not for use longer than one week without doctor advice
